Chlorine spill keeps residents indoors
NANUET(AP)—A spill from a tank truck carrying 3,500 gallons of chlorine shut down a street temporarily in a suburban New York condominium complex in Nanuet.
Nanuet authorities said the spill occurred about 10 a. m. Friday. No injuries were reported. No homes were immediately evacuated, but residents were asked to remain indoors until the area was cleaned up.
Fire officials said a problem with the truck’s hose and connector caused the accident.
They also said some of the chemical ran off into a nearby brook connected to the complex’s sewer system.
But officials said recent rain quickly diluted it.
Nanuet is in Rockland County, near the New Jersey state line.
